COKING COAL DAILY: Seaborne market steady as weather bureau downgrades cyclone

By Deepali Sharma / April 04, 2018 / www.metalbulletin.com / Article Link

The seaborne coking coal market was steady on Wednesday April 4 as market participants continued to monitor the weather in the coal producing hub of Queensland, Australia.

Late evening on Wednesday, the Queensland Weather Bureau cancelled the tropical cyclone Warning for the Queensland coast.
